Yangwei Liu is a scholar working on Computational Mechanics, Aerospace Engineering and Mechanical Engineering. According to data from OpenAlex, Yangwei Liu has authored 76 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 63 papers in Computational Mechanics, 49 papers in Aerospace Engineering and 23 papers in Mechanical Engineering. Recurrent topics in Yangwei Liu’s work include Fluid Dynamics and Turbulent Flows (52 papers), Turbomachinery Performance and Optimization (47 papers) and Heat Transfer Mechanisms (20 papers). Yangwei Liu is often cited by papers focused on Fluid Dynamics and Turbulent Flows (52 papers), Turbomachinery Performance and Optimization (47 papers) and Heat Transfer Mechanisms (20 papers). Yangwei Liu collaborates with scholars based in China, United Kingdom and France. Yangwei Liu's co-authors include Lipeng Lu, Yumeng Tang, Hao Yan, Le Fang, Baojie Liu, Qiushi Li, Xianjun Yu, Feng Gao, David J. Kelly and Qiushi Li and has published in prestigious journals such as Molecular Microbiology, Applied Microbiology and Biotechnology and Physics Letters A.
